Hey Cram, you'll know this.  Whats the name of that effect where people selectively ignore the negative or erroneous stuff when their personality is being described?  You know, like with astrology and stuff?

The Forer Effect.

Thats it!

I just wanted to mention it, so people would keep it in mind.

I'm sortof torn on personality tests.  I find them fascinating, especially of people I've known a long time, but I'm also suspicious of them, especially if its only the person themselves who can see the resemblance.

I actually am amused partly because that description of INFJ was the most flattering one I've ever seen. It completely omitted the dictatorial, pigheaded, contrary, elitist, steamroller aspects of the personality type.

Then again, I almost imagine that each "type" would require a whole book for really substantive description, and like you, I'm not sure how much stock I put in the whole thing (except that I've consistently tested INFJ for years, and it does describe me fairly accurately... or at least, it describes how I see myself fairly accurately.)
